HomeMy WebLinkAboutCC Reso No 2020-035 Calling November 3, 2020 General ElectionRESOLUTION NO. 2020-35 A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F LAKE ELSINORE, CALIFORNIA, CALLING FOR THE HOLDING OF A GENERAL MUNICIPAL ELECTION TO BE HELD ON TUESDAY, NOVEMBER 3, 2020, FOR THE ELECTION OF CERTAIN OFFICERS AS REQUIRED BY THE PROVISIONS OF THE LAWS OF THE STATE OF CALIFORNIA RELATING TO GENERAL LAW CITIES Whereas, under Section 2.09.010 Lake Elsinore Municipal Code and the provisions of the laws relating to general law cities in the State of California, a General Municipal Election shall be held on November 3, 2020, for the election of Municipal Officers. NOW, THEREFORE, TH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F LAKE ELSINORE, CALIFORNIA, DOES RESOLVE, DECLARE, DETERMINE AND ORDER AS FOLLOWS: Section 1. That pursuant to the requirements of Section 2.09.010 Lake Elsinore Municipal Code and the laws of the State of California relating to general law cities, there is called and ordered to be held in the City of Lake Elsinore, California, on Tuesday, November 3, 2020, a General Municipal Election, for the purpose of electing three Members of the City Council, District Nos. 2, 4, and 5 and one Treasurer, for a full term of four years. Section 2. That the ballots to be used at the election shall be in form and content as required by law. Section 3. That the City Clerk is authorized, instructed and directed to coordinate with the County of Riverside Registrar-Recorder/County Clerk to procure and furnish any and all official ballots, notices, printed matter and all supplies, equipment and paraphernalia that may be necessary in order to properly and lawfully conduct the election. Section 4. That the polls for the election shall be open at seven o’clock a.m. of the day of the election and shall remain open continuously from that time until eight o’clock p.m. of the same day when the polls shall be closed pursuant to Election Code § 10242, except as provided in of the Elections Code §14401 or as may be required by amendment to the Elections Code or by Executive Order or instruction by the State of California or the County of Riverside Registrar- Recorder/County Clerk in response to the COVID-19 or other state of emergency. Section 5. That in all particulars not recited in this Resolution, the election shall be held and conducted as provided by law for holding municipal elections. Section 6. That notice of the time and place of holding the election is given and the City Clerk is authorized, instructed and directed to give further or additional notice of the election, in time, form and manner as required by law. Section 7. That in the event of a tie vote (if any two or more persons receive an equal and the highest number of votes for an office) as certified by the County of Riverside Registrar- Recorder/County Clerk, the City Council, in accordance with Election Code § 15651(a), shall set a date and time and place and summon the candidates who have received the tie votes to appear and will determine the tie by lot.
